Arriving at Denham Markets, you’ll find the rhythm of the day set by fresh ocean breezes and the distant call of seabirds. The market’s layout is compact but diverse, stretching along the town’s main street just steps from the waterfront. Here, the salt-tinged air seems to dare you to explore the tables full of seasonal fruits, handwoven baskets, and seafood harvested from the nearby waters. Vendors, fiercely proud of their wares, offer their goods with a straightforward passion, ready to talk about everything from fishing techniques to art inspired by the surrounding wilderness.

Practicality underlines the market's appeal. It’s an ideal spot to stock up on essentials before a day of exploring Shark Bay’s wonders or to grab a locally made snack when hunger strikes. The market runs every Sunday morning, from dawn until early afternoon—a perfect start for those wanting to align their adventuring with fresh provisions. Footwear? Comfortable walking shoes are a must as the market blends into Denham’s laid-back streets where you’ll want to wander and absorb.

Frequently Asked Questions

When exactly do Denham Markets operate?

Denham Markets take place every Sunday from around 7:00 AM until 1:00 PM, giving visitors ample time for a morning visit before heading out for other activities.

What kinds of products can I expect to find at the market?

Expect fresh seafood caught locally, seasonal fruits and vegetables, handmade crafts, indigenous art, preserves, and baked goods reflecting Denham’s coastal culture.

Are the markets wheelchair accessible?

The markets are spread along paved streets with generally flat terrain, making them accessible for wheelchairs and those with limited mobility, though some stalls may have tighter spaces.

Is parking available near the markets?

Yes, limited parking is available near the market area. It’s best to arrive early or consider walking from accommodation within Denham to avoid crowding.

Can visitors interact with vendors about local fishing or farming?

Absolutely. Vendors are generally happy to share stories about their fishing methods, farming practices, and cultural significance of their products, making for a rich learning experience.

Are pets allowed at Denham Markets?

Pets are generally discouraged to respect local health regulations and the comfort of all visitors, with service animals exceptioned as per Australian standards.
